• Добро пожаловать на Форум пользователей ПО АСКОН. Пожалуйста, авторизуйтесь.
 

Уважаемые пользователи,

Хотим проинформировать вас о режиме работы регистрации на нашем сайте.

Регистрация будет доступна с 8:00 (мск) 12 января.

Благодарим вас за понимание и сотрудничество. Мы ценим ваше терпение и стремимся предоставить вам лучший опыт использования нашего сервиса.

С уважением,
Команда Ascon

Сохранять ID тела, что бы модифицирующие операции не ломались после отмены связи

Автор TV-child, 14.02.26, 13:29:04

« назад - далее »

0 Пользователи и 1 гость просматривают эту тему.

TV-child

Добрый день!

Предлагаю сохранять внутреннюю адресацию тел / ID тел, что бы модифицирующие операции не выпадали в ошибку после включения выключения обновления со связанным телом.

К примеру. В Компас 23.0.0.2180.

Я создаю файл сборки и создаю там отдельными телами все детали. Далее в предварительно созданные пустые файлы деталей инструментом "Копировать объекты", включив в меню "Фильтровать все объекты" тип фильтра "Тела", я копирую соответствующие тела. В уже скопированном теле я добавляю резьбу или что-то отрезаю, изменяю размеры граней. И стоит только обновить тело или включить/выключить автоматическое обновление, как все эти операции в скопированном теле выпадают в ошибку, так как операции теряют исходное тело. Причин для такой потери я не вижу. Предлагаю исправить этот недочёт.

СВ

 Похоже, вы очень полюбили тему "Создать Сборку не из Деталей, а из тел. Делать чертежи из тел". И то и дело обнаруживаете проблему за проблемой.
 Предположу, что АСКОН не захочет поменять (точнее - сделать полноценно-совершенно работающей) свою схему Сборка-Детали-Чертёжи+СП на Сборка-Тела-Чер..., и не станет устранять все косяки/противоречия/недоработки. И понятно почему ...
- - -
По Предложению - за. Если это косяк Компаса - в чём надо ещё убедиться..

TV-child

Компасу вменяют в вину его медленную работу на крупных сборках. Я тоже в этом убеждался на практике.

При этом даже NX 10 умудряется без тормозов работать с очень крупными сборками. Но там применяется WAVE-технология, где моделируют в одном файле множеством тел, а потом делают "статичный" слепок без истории построения. Такие "отлинкованные" сборки не содержат деталей с  историей построения, как правило даже не содержат сопряжений. Созданные таким образом сборки в NX умудряются работать без тормозов даже при очень большом количестве деталей.

Ещё одним плюсом создания сборки из тел является то, что проработка конструкции идёт быстрее, на диске не растёт гора бесполезных файлов для каждой из версий конструкции, а архивирование старых версий заключается в переносе единственного файла.

Короче говоря, я выбрал этот путь в надежде на ускорение работы Компаса, упрощения проработки конструкций и архивирования старых версий при проработке.

TV-child

Но, как обычно, Компас сказал "А", но не сказал "Б"!

Копирование геометрии не позволяет скопировать резьбу, из-за чего её приходится дорисовывать в скопированной геометрии. Из-за чего "линкование" частично теряет свою оперативность. И зачатую обновление геометрии не происходит по неизвестным причинам. А уж если обновилось, то рисуй резьбу заново.

Если в NX инструмент размещения компонента очень гибкий и многофункциональный, что частенько позволяет вообще не использовать сопряжения, то в Компасе инструмент размещения компонентов имеет очень бедный функционал.

В итоге получается, что Компас как бы сделал аналог WAVE-технологии, но сделал так, что им особо пользоваться неудобно. Будто бы разработчики повторяли за NX, но без понимания конечной цели своих действий. Иил, может быть, из-за профессиональной гордости: мол, сделаем по-другом лишь бы не как у них.

А мне как пользователю всё равно повторяют они за кем-то или нет, если это удобно и эффективно, то пусть хоть точь-в-точь копируют.

СВ

Цитата: TV-child от 14.02.26, 14:15:55Если в NX инструмент размещения компонента очень гибкий и многофункциональный, что частенько позволяет вообще не использовать сопряжения, то в Компасе инструмент размещения компонентов имеет очень бедный функционал.
Вы "пришли" из NX?
(А как там организовано движение? В Компасе сопряжения позволяют осуществлять движение, а за счёт чего это в NX?)
Если отбросить обнаруженные косяки, то остальная работа с телами позволяет получать полностью параметризованные Чертежи+СП (т.е. ТА ЖЕ чёткая связь моделей и чертежей, что и при схеме Сборка-Детали-Чертёжи+СП)?

TV-child

Изначально работал в Компасе. Потом в других программах в т.ч. и NX. И там, в NX, тоже есть сопряжения и ими тоже можно точно так же пользоваться, всё как в Компас.

Не совсем понял, что имеется в виду под "движениями". Если кинематика, когда, например, задали соосность на осях коленвала и кривошипа и можем покрутить его, а поршни будут ходить туда-сюда, то так же как и в Компас - сопряжениями.

Цитата: СВ от 14.02.26, 17:06:58Если отбросить обнаруженные косяки, то остальная работа с телами позволяет получать полностью параметризованные Чертежи+СП (т.е. ТА ЖЕ чёткая связь моделей и чертежей, что и при схеме Сборка-Детали-Чертёжи+СП)?
Пока что всё работает: статичный слепок (тело без истории, созданное инструментом "Копировать объекты") делается, с него делается чертёж, сборка и спецификация автоматически получается. Так как все тела висят в нужных координатах, то сборка не содержит сопряжений, всё зафиксировано и ресурсы не тратятся на пересчёт сопряжений. Хотя, при окончательном размещении деталей сопряжения и так можно удалить, зафиксировав объекты, независимо от метода создания сборки.

СВ

 Вы попробовали классику Компаса - Сборка=Детали/подсборки+сопряжения, попробовали под NX - телами, в итоге что приглянулось (если не брать косяки)? (Кстати, в какой области эта работа, может там какая-то своя специфика?)

Soultaker

Цитата: TV-child от 14.02.26, 14:06:36Компасу вменяют в вину его медленную работу на крупных сборках. Я тоже в этом убеждался на практике.

При этом даже NX 10 умудряется без тормозов работать с очень крупными сборками. Но там применяется WAVE-технология, где моделируют в одном файле множеством тел, а потом делают "статичный" слепок без истории построения. Такие "отлинкованные" сборки не содержат деталей с  историей построения, как правило даже не содержат сопряжений. Созданные таким образом сборки в NX умудряются работать без тормозов даже при очень большом количестве деталей.

Ещё одним плюсом создания сборки из тел является то, что проработка конструкции идёт быстрее, на диске не растёт гора бесполезных файлов для каждой из версий конструкции, а архивирование старых версий заключается в переносе единственного файла.

Короче говоря, я выбрал этот путь в надежде на ускорение работы Компаса, упрощения проработки конструкций и архивирования старых версий при проработке.
Это где такая методология в NX всё телами делать?

TV-child

Цитата: Soultaker от Вчера в 00:34:02Это где такая методология в NX всё телами делать?
Во всех фирмах, где я работал и где был внедрён NX и ТимЦентр, работали таким образом. Везде телами, везде WAVE-технология, контрольные структуры, рабочие части, линки и всё такое. Ну и свой программист, который должен этот ТимЦентр предварительно настраивать, обслуживать, писать какие-то штуки к нему, что бы выгружались спецификации и вообще эта махина под названием ТимЦентр работала.

СВ

 Т.е. моделирование в NX телами - не из "коробки"? Или, скорее, из "коробки", но с доп. теложвижнениями?

TV-child

Само моделирование телами "из коробки". И WAVE-технология "из коробки". Всё это делается на локалке, на одном компе без проблем и ТимЦентр не требуется. Просто, зачастую, но не всегда, там где NX там и ТимЦентр. На Рутубе есть уроки, там можно про всё это посмотреть.